The Power of Aotearoa: New Zealand’s Renewable Energy Landscape

New Zealand boasts one of the highest proportions of renewable electricity generation in the world. Its unique geology and abundant natural resources have laid a strong foundation for a sustainable energy future. While hydropower has historically been the cornerstone, a blend of other renewables is rapidly expanding.

Hydroelectricity: The Backbone

For decades, New Zealand has harnessed its plentiful rainfall and mountainous terrain to generate clean hydroelectricity. This reliable energy source accounts for a significant portion of the country’s power, providing a stable base for the grid.

“New Zealand’s commitment to renewable energy is deeply rooted in its geography, with hydroelectric power remaining a dominant and reliable force in its energy mix.”

Geothermal: A Natural Advantage

Sitting on the Pacific Ring of Fire, New Zealand has vast geothermal resources, particularly in the North Island. This consistent, base-load renewable energy source offers a significant advantage, providing a constant supply independent of weather conditions.

Stat Callout: Approximately 17% of New Zealand’s electricity comes from geothermal sources, making it one of the largest geothermal energy producers globally. (Source: MBIE)

Wind Power: Tapping into the Breezes

The ‘land of the long white cloud’ is also a land of strong winds. Wind farms are increasingly dotting the New Zealand landscape, contributing a growing share to the national grid and diversifying the renewable portfolio.

Advanced Solar Solutions: Beyond Rooftops

Solar power is rapidly gaining traction. Beyond standard rooftop installations, innovations include larger-scale solar farms, floating solar arrays, and building-integrated photovoltaics (BIPV) that turn structures themselves into energy generators. This expanded approach is crucial for meeting increased demand.

Battery Energy Storage Systems (BESS): Storing Tomorrow’s Power

The intermittency of wind and solar power has long been a challenge. BESS technology is a game-changer, allowing excess energy generated during peak production to be stored and released when needed. This enhances grid stability and reliability, especially for remote communities and during peak demand periods.

Stat Callout: Global battery storage capacity is projected to grow significantly, with New Zealand actively integrating utility-scale and residential battery solutions to optimize its renewable assets. (Source: IEA reports, local energy providers)

Green Hydrogen: The Future Fuel?

Produced by splitting water using renewable electricity, green hydrogen offers a clean energy carrier for hard-to-decarbonize sectors like heavy transport and industrial processes. New Zealand is exploring pilot projects and investment into this promising technology, aiming to leverage its abundant renewable resources to become a green hydrogen exporter.

Smart Grids and Digitalization: Optimizing Distribution

A truly revolutionary energy system isn’t just about generation; it’s also about intelligent distribution. Smart grids use digital technology to monitor, control, and optimize energy flow, allowing for better integration of distributed renewables, demand-side management, and improved resilience against outages. This includes AI-driven forecasting and automation.

Government Commitments and Incentives

New Zealand has ambitious climate targets, including aiming for 100% renewable electricity by 2030 in a normal hydrological year. Government policies, investment funds, and regulatory frameworks are crucial in facilitating the transition, encouraging innovation, and supporting infrastructure development.

Empowering Local Communities

Community-led energy projects are blossoming across New Zealand. These initiatives, from local solar installations to microgrids, empower citizens, foster energy independence, and ensure that the benefits of the energy transition are shared broadly.

Frequently Asked Questions (FAQ)

What percentage of New Zealand’s electricity currently comes from renewable sources?

New Zealand typically generates around 85-90% of its electricity from renewable sources, primarily hydro, geothermal, and wind, depending on annual hydrological conditions.

What are the biggest challenges for New Zealand in achieving 100% renewable energy?

Key challenges include managing the intermittency of wind and solar, ensuring grid stability with diverse energy sources, the need for significant infrastructure investment, and decarbonizing sectors like industrial heat and transport that are harder to electrify.

How can individuals contribute to New Zealand’s renewable energy goals?

Individuals can contribute by adopting energy-efficient practices, installing rooftop solar where feasible, choosing an electricity retailer with a strong renewable energy focus, investing in electric vehicles, and supporting local community energy initiatives.

What is Green Hydrogen and why is it important for New Zealand?

Green Hydrogen is hydrogen produced using renewable electricity to split water. It’s important for New Zealand because it can act as a clean energy carrier for sectors difficult to electrify (like heavy transport or industrial processes) and offers a potential export opportunity, leveraging NZ’s abundant renewable resources.
